I have strafe RGB keyboard with 6 QL fans connected to Lightning Node Core and Commander Pro. Everything works well but whenever I launch any apps or games that support light integration my keyboard and only 4 of the fans will change color. The other 2 fans the led's will just be off... I was expecting all 6 fans will change color. Is this a known bug?:bigeyes:

Possible the QL have not been integrated into those games. I don't know how that process works, if it has to be approved by each software vendor, etc. There also is some strange 4 QL limit on some devices because of the huge number of LEDs. That doesn't apply to the Commander Pro, but perhaps they were programmed to think you can only have 4 QL max on any 1 device.

You can connect the external steps to an LNP or ComPro then they will act as normal strips.

 

I have 3 LS100(Arduino) and use one for screen backlighting but as soon as I start FC5 it goes black, so no screen lighting. If I play games without iCUE integration, the integration is better because the normal video lighting does their job.

Chances are the LS100 is like the QL and not implemented because it's new. However, wouldn't we need a toggle for it so it can be included with the other effects or not and used as video lighting? As they are the SDK effects are a master override for all devices and you can't selectively take a few out. Not sure everyone would be happy with it on the back side of the monitor.

 

My LS100 is in strip mode and does not light for D2 or Metro. I am sure the effects are programmed on a device basis.
